Answer:


Explanation:

x+5y = -2

x+5y =4

these lines are parallel

they have the same slope but different y intercepts

inconsistent


y = 3x+4

-2x+y =4 y = 2x+4

different slopes same y intercept

they intersect at one point

consistent and independent


3x+y =4 y = -3x+4

-6x-2y = -8 -2y =6x-8 y = -3x +4

same slope same y intercept

they are the same line

consistent and dependent (coincident)
